Intelligent scenic spot tourist safety service system based on GIS interoperation and LBS

The invention discloses an intelligent scenic spot tourist safety service system based on GIS interoperation and LBS. The system comprises a client, a server and a service monitoring center. Based on an automatic and intelligent interoperation protocol and a standard between a GIS server and a LBS mobile terminal, aiming at tourists, the system realizes position association, automatic position state perception, active early warning and concurrent linkage of multiple monitoring means. A safe think tank makes a decision so as to realize bidirectional high-efficiency position safety information interaction of the tourists and a scenic spot and a timely and rapid rescue service. The system is combined with A-GPS or Big Dipper, a base station and a WiFi positioning mode to acquire accurate position information of the tourists and working personnel in the scenic spot. On an aspect of a GIS interoperation server, an intelligent and automatic GIS space analysis algorithm is designed. A mobile terminal uses an APP to acquire a function support of the server. Precision and efficiency of safe monitoring and early warning of the scenic spot are increased; forecasting and early warning are performed; accident rescue work of the personnel in each scenic spot is scientifically guided and tourist safety is guaranteed.

Service-oriented development framework (YC-Framework)

The invention provides a service-oriented development framework (YC-Framework). The service-oriented development framework mainly comprises an API (application program interface) layer, a communication protocol layer, a data logic layer, a system service layer, a public assembly and uniform configuration. In the system service layer, various function services in service products are extracted through an SOA (service oriented architecture) to form services with high multiplex ratios, serve service logic in all the service products in an independent service form, and provide stable and robust bottom layer system service support for the external; the logic layering design is introduced, and interconnection is performed through the simple logic relation of upper and lower layers; configuration management for each layer is realized through uniform configuration, and work including routing, safety protection and the like is implemented by the aid of the public assembly; finally, the high-load, extensible, maintainable and rapidly-iterative service-oriented development framework (YC-Framework) is obtained. The YC-Framework has good characteristics of service singleton, loose coupling, protocol standardization, cross-platform property, cross-language property and the like.

A system architecture of a digital factory in the textile printing and dyeing industry

The invention discloses an overall structure of a digital factory in the textile printing and dyeing industry, comprising a device layer, a sensing layer, a network layer and an application layer, wherein the device layer is in signal connection with the sensing layer, the sensing layer is in signal connecrtion with the network layer, and the network layer is in signal connection with the application layer. The device layer is used for carrying out concrete actual production and production-related processes of a textile printing and dyeing factory; the sensing layer is used for realizing the acquisition of the production and production-related data information of the textile printing and dyeing equipment corresponding to the device layer. The network layer is used for realizing the transmission of the information obtained by the sensing layer. The application layer establishes a corresponding database according to the collected information, and is used for realizing the functions of supply chain analysis and optimization, equipment and system fault diagnosis and prediction, quality management and analysis, production planning and scheduling, etc. Through the implementation of the industrial internet of things, the invention realizes the overall interconnected wireless coverage of the production equipment, realizes the mobility and paperlessness, and creates the intelligent manufacturing basic environment of Anytime, Anywhere and Anydivision.

Data acquisition and application snapshot method of filling station

The invention relates to the field of information technologies and automation and discloses a data acquisition and application snapshot method of a filling station. The method comprises the following steps of performing second-level sampling on oil tank information and storing into an oil tank information base and a real-time information base, performing second-level real-time oil outlet information on an oil gun, and storing into an oil gun information base and the real-time information base, acquiring oil gun transaction information and storing into a transaction information base, a transaction snapshot information base and the real-time information base, acquiring oil gun and oil tank information at regular time and storing in a history snapshot information base, judging whether an alarm condition is met, judging whether oil tank stock reaches an oil discharge standard, calculating whether a variation of oil reserve of the oil tank meets a condition, and extracting data from the oil tank information base, the transaction information base and the transaction snapshot information base for loss calculation. The method can simplify business operation, improves working efficiency, monitors and eliminates potential safety hazards in real time, provides a high-efficiency oil discharge mechanism, automatically applies delivery, performs oil discharge statistics, and greatly reduces the data size of transmission and storage.

Capsule sorting mechanism with high sorting efficiency

The invention relates to a capsule sorting mechanism with high sorting efficiency. The capsule sorting mechanism comprises a rack, wherein a rectangular cavity and a waste conveyor trough are formed in a mounting base of the rack, a drive roll and a driven roll are arranged in the rectangular cavity, and a transparent conveying belt is wound on the drive roll and the driven roll; an inlet of the waste conveyor trough is communicated with the rectangular cavity, an outlet of the waste conveyor trough is formed in the side surface of the mounting base, and a first lower chute is formed under the outlet of the waste conveyor trough; a second lower chute is formed in the lower end of a discharge hole of a hopper in front of the rack, and the lower end of the second lower chute is positioned right above the transparent conveying belt; a temporary discharge hole is formed in the bottom of the rectangular cavity, a cover board covers the temporary discharge hole, and the cover board is articulated at the bottom of the rectangular cavity; and a delivery pipe is arranged at the rear end of the mounting base. The capsule sorting mechanism is convenient and has a labor-saving effect, the labor intensity is alleviated, the sorting efficiency is improved, capsule contamination can be avoided, overflow capsules can be prevented from treatment, the production efficiency is improved, the treatment procedure is reduced, the high-efficiency and high-quality production requirement is met and the production process is optimized.

Business process analysis apparatus

A business process analysis apparatus that can predict an activity improvement effect with a certain accuracy and can preferentially apply improvements to activities having higher predicted improvement effect values among the individual activities forming the entire business process. The business process analysis apparatus has an activity database in which at least an activity quantity, an output type, and an output quantity are stored by being associated with one another for each of the activities forming the business process, and performs a process including: selecting an activity belonging to the business process under analysis as an analysis target activity; acquiring the activity quantity, output type, and output quantity of the analysis target activity; retrieving any activity having the same output type as the output type of the analysis target activity; obtaining activity efficiency based on the activity quantity and output quantity of the retrieved activity; determining reference efficiency based on at least one activity efficiency thus obtained; and computing activity improvement effect by calculating a difference between the activity quantity of the analysis target activity and the activity quantity that would be required if the analysis target activity were performed with the reference efficiency. The above process is performed on every analysis target activity.
